The expansion introduces several specialized roofing systems designed to alter thermal absorption and material usage across varied climate conditions found in western Oregon. Among the updated material options are recycled metal roofing structures, cool roof reflective technologies, and vegetated green roof systems. Recycled metal roofs utilize repurposed post-consumer metals, offering an alternative to single-use roofing materials that are frequently discarded during standard structural replacements. Cool roofing systems feature high-reflectance coatings engineered to reflect sunlight and limit heat absorption, which can alter internal building temperatures during warm summer periods. Additionally, green roofing options utilize living vegetation layers that absorb rainwater and provide supplemental thermal insulation for commercial and residential structures.
